As a part of the education, education punishment always attracts people's attention. The argument of education punishment mainly lies in the rationality to exist and the feasibility to implement. On these two focuses, people research education punishment from different aspects. However, they cannot explain the reasons of education punishment's existence, because theyforgetting a very important factor-human nature. Every man knows that man is aim and objectin the course of education. Every man is living and special. So, education punishment has to face human nature. As a species, men have their common personalities, which is also the base to practice education punishment in the view of the theory of human nature. Therefore, this essay will elaborate the reasons, aims, principle and ways of education punishment's existence in the view of theory of human nature. It will help people practice education punishment according to human nature, and make education punishment more valid.There are six parts in this essay:Part one: Forewords. It introduces the reasons and the meanings to write this essay, and give previous researches simple classifications and point their flaws.Part two: To define the concept. Comparing the Chinese and foreign human nature theory, I proposed a concept which is more objective and comprehensive. Human nature is the common personalities which man is inherent or acquired by learning. Human nature is embodied by four relationships: man and material, man and spirit, man and other, man and himself, and it is a compound body of material and spirit, sensibility and ration, individual character and general character, discipline and self-discipline. Moreover, a new concept of education punishment is offered while many people limit the main body and object of education punishment.Part three: Hypothesis of human nature to practice education punishment. Man has four demands: material, spirit, collective and ego. These factors show people's human nature when they deal with them, and they are also the base to practice the education punishment in the view of the theory of human nature. Part four: The aims of education punishment in the view of the theory of human nature. Ideas of material, moral, collective and ego of man show that education punishment can shape human nature.Part five: The principles to practice the education punishment in the view of the theory of human nature. For complexities of human nature, practice education punishment must according to principles as following: unity of materials and spirits, unity of sensibility and ration, unity of individual character and general character, unity of discipline and self-discipline.Part six: The methods to practice education punishment in the view of the theory of human nature. According contents of human nature, we get seven education punishment methods such as physical punishment, objective punishment, school work punishment, psychic punishment, collective punishment and self- punishment. Analyzing their advantages and disadvantages one by one, we get a conclusion at last.
